Gum disease, also known as periodontal disease, is a common but serious dental condition that affects many residents in Carina and beyond. It involves inflammation and infection of the gums and supporting tissues of the teeth, and if left untreated, can lead to tooth loss and other health complications.The early stage of gum disease is called gingivitis.
It is typically caused by poor oral hygiene, which allows plaque – a sticky film of bacteria – to build up on the teeth and gum line. Symptoms include red, swollen gums that may bleed during brushing or flossing. Gingivitis is reversible with professional cleaning and improved home care.If gingivitis is not addressed, it can progress to periodontitis, a more advanced form of gum disease Carina. In this stage, the inner layer of the gum pulls away from the teeth, forming pockets that can become infected.
As the body tries to fight the infection, it breaks down the bone and connective tissue holding the teeth in place.In Carina, dental clinics are well-equipped to diagnose and treat gum disease at any stage. Treatment often begins with a deep cleaning procedure called scaling and root planing, which removes plaque and tartar from below the gum line.
In more severe cases, surgical options or laser therapy may be necessary.Preventing gum disease is possible through daily brushing and flossing, regular dental check-ups, and a healthy diet.
